Choosing The Right Substrate For Aquatic Plants In A Freshwater Tank
The substrate serves as the base on which most plants thrive. Choosing the right substrate for your aquatic plants is essential for their growth and overall health. Here are some of the factors to consider when selecting the right substrate for your freshwater tank.
Nutrient content: Aquatic plants require nutrients to grow, just like any other plant. The substrate you choose should have enough nutrients to support the growth of your plants. These nutrients can be divided into two – Macro and micro:
- Macronutrients: Needed in large quantities and include elements such as nitrogen, phosphorus, and potassium
- Micronutrients: Needed in trace amounts and include elements such as iron, manganese, and boron.
Some substrates come pre-packaged with nutrients, while others require the addition of fertilizers.
Porosity: The substrate should be porous enough to allow water and nutrients to flow through it. This allows the roots of the plants to absorb nutrients and oxygen easily. A substrate that is too dense can prevent proper root growth and lead to the accumulation of harmful gases. A substrate that is too loose would make it very difficult for the plants to take root. Additionally, it could get kicked up very easily giving the aquarium a dirty look.
Grain size: The grain size of the substrate is another important factor to consider. Extremely small-grained substrates can become compacted over time, making it difficult for plant roots to penetrate. Larger-grained substrates provide better aeration and allow water to flow freely. A substrate that is too coarse, however, can damage delicate plant roots. It will also have plenty of open spaces which is not ideal for live plants.
pH level: The pH level of the substrate should be compatible with the type of plants you plan to grow. Some plants thrive in acidic conditions, while others prefer a more alkaline environment. Make sure to research the pH requirements of the plants you plan to keep and choose a substrate that will support their growth. Some substrates like some river soil may decrease the pH while others like crushed corals will do the opposite. Many substrate like stones and pebbles may not affect pH at all.
Appearance: The appearance of the substrate is another factor to consider. Many substrates come in a range of colors, from natural browns and blacks to bright and vibrant colors. Choose a substrate that complements the overall aesthetic of your tank.
Price: Finally, consider the price of the substrate. Some substrates can be quite expensive, while others are more affordable. Keep in mind that a high-quality substrate can provide long-term benefits for your plants and the overall health of your tank.
Lighting Requirements For Live Aquarium Plants In Freshwater And Tropical Fish Tanks
Live aquarium plants require appropriate lighting to grow and thrive in freshwater and tropical fish tanks. Different plant species have different lighting requirements, but there are some general guidelines you can follow to provide the necessary lighting for most aquatic plants. Here are some important factors to consider when selecting lighting for your live aquarium plants:
- Light intensity: The intensity of the light is an essential factor for aquatic plants’ growth. Light intensity is measured in units of lux or PAR (Photosynthetically Active Radiation), and most aquatic plants require a minimum of 30-50 PAR. If the lighting is too weak, the plants will struggle to photosynthesize and grow. If it is too strong, it can cause algae overgrowth, which can harm the plants.
- Light duration: The duration of lighting is also important for plant growth. Most aquatic plants require a minimum of 8-10 hours of light per day to grow well. Some plant species may need more or less than this. Research the specific needs of the plants you plan to keep.
- Light color temperature: Light color temperature is measured in Kelvin (K), and it determines the color of the light. Most aquatic plants do well with a light temperature between 5000K and 7000K, which produces a white to slightly blue light. However, some plants require a reddish light, which can be achieved with bulbs that have a color temperature of around 3000K.
- Light spectrum: Light spectrum refers to the wavelengths of light emitted by the bulb. For plants to photosynthesize effectively, they require both red and blue wavelengths with a bit of yellow thrown in. Most aquarium lighting systems are designed to provide a spectrum that is suitable for plant growth.
- Light source: There are various types of light sources available for aquarium plants, including fluorescent, LED, and metal halide bulbs. Each type of light source has its advantages and disadvantages, and you should choose one based on your needs, budget, and the plants you plan to keep. LEDs offer the best overall experience.
- Light placement: The placement of the lighting is also crucial for plant growth. The light should be evenly distributed throughout the tank, and it should be positioned so that it doesn’t create shadows or hot spots. Ensure that the light fixture is not too close to the water surface, as it can cause excessive evaporation and heat.
Common Mistakes To Avoid When Starting An Aquascape With Live Aquarium Plants
Starting an aquascape with live aquarium plants can be an enjoyable and rewarding experience. However, there are some common mistakes that beginners make that can lead to frustration and disappointment. Here are some mistakes to avoid when starting an aquascape with live aquarium plants:
- Not doing enough research: One of the most common mistakes beginners make is not doing enough research before starting an aquascape. Learn about the specific requirements of the plants you are planning to keep, lighting requirements, water parameters, and other important factors that can impact plant growth.
- Choosing the wrong plants: Another common mistake is choosing the wrong plants for your tank or plants that aren’t compatible with each other. Some plants are more challenging to grow than others and may require more specific lighting or water conditions. Be sure to choose plants that are suitable for your tank size, lighting, and water parameters. They should also share similar care requirements.
- Overcrowding the tank: Overcrowding your tank with too many plants can lead to poor growth and health. Be sure to leave enough space between plants to allow for proper growth and nutrient uptake. The lush green look doesn’t happen overnight.
Not providing enough light: Live aquarium plants require adequate lighting to grow and thrive. Be sure to provide enough light for the plants you plan to keep and ensure that the lighting is evenly distributed throughout the tank. - Not maintaining proper water parameters: Water parameters such as pH, temperature, and nutrient levels can impact plant growth. Be sure to monitor these parameters regularly and make any necessary adjustments to ensure that your plants are thriving.
- Neglecting regular maintenance: Regular maintenance is essential for the health and growth of your plants. Be sure to perform water changes, prune dead or decaying plant matter, and maintain proper water circulation to ensure that your plants are healthy and thriving.
Types Of Live Aquarium Plants Suitable For Beginners
If you’re new to the world of live aquarium plants, it can be overwhelming to choose the right plants for your tank. There are many different types of live aquarium plants available, and some can be more challenging to grow than others. Here are some of the best types of live aquarium plants suitable for beginners:
- Anubias: Anubias is a group of hardy plants that is easy to care for and can grow in low to moderate lighting. It can be attached to rocks or driftwood and does not require a nutrient-rich substrate. Anubias can tolerate a wide range of water parameters and can be a great addition to any freshwater aquarium. The most popular Anubias varieties include the Barteri and the Nana.
- Java fern: Java fern is another hardy plant that is easy to care for and can grow in low to moderate lighting. It can be attached to rocks or driftwood and does not require a nutrient-rich substrate. Java fern can tolerate a wide range of water parameters and can be a great addition to any freshwater aquarium.
- Hornwort: Hornwort is a fast-growing plant that is great if you need to fill up an aquarium quickly. It can be planted in the substrate or left to float, and it can grow in a wide range of lighting conditions. Keep in mind that this plant requires regular pruning or it will overcrowd the tank.
- Amazon sword: Amazon sword is a popular aquarium plant that can grow up to 20 inches tall. It requires moderate to high lighting and a nutrient-rich substrate to thrive. They look excellent as background plants.
- Cryptocoryne: Cryptocoryne is a slow-growing plant that can tolerate low to moderate lighting and does not require a nutrient-rich substrate. It works well as a centrepiece plant.
- Java moss: Java moss is a hardy plant that can be attached to rocks or driftwood and does not require a nutrient-rich substrate. It can grow in low to moderate lighting. It provides a natural and mossy look to your aquascape.
Fertilization Techniques For A Thriving Planted Aquarium
Fertilization is a crucial component of maintaining a thriving planted aquarium. Proper fertilization provides essential nutrients that live aquarium plants need to grow, develop, and thrive. Here are some fertilization techniques for a thriving planted aquarium:
Liquid fertilizers: Liquid fertilizers are a popular choice for many aquarium hobbyists. They are easy to use and can provide a wide range of nutrients, including macronutrients and micronutrients. Liquid fertilizers should be added to the aquarium according to the manufacturer’s instructions.
Root tabs: Root tabs are small pellets that are inserted into the substrate near the plant roots. They release nutrients into the substrate over time, providing essential nutrients to the plant roots. Root tabs are an excellent choice for heavy root feeders like Amazon swords and crypts.
CO2 injection: CO2 injection can help to improve plant growth by providing essential carbon dioxide to the plants. Carbon dioxide is a crucial component of photosynthesis, and many plants require higher levels of CO2 than are naturally present in the aquarium. CO2 injection can be achieved through a variety of methods, including CO2 injection systems, DIY yeast-based systems, and liquid CO2 supplements. However, you can build stunning aquascapes without a dedicated CO2 system.
Fish waste: Fish waste can be a valuable source of nutrients for live aquarium plants. It contains essential macronutrients like nitrogen, phosphorus, and potassium, which can help to support plant growth. However, it is essential to avoid overfeeding your fish, as excess fish waste can lead to poor water quality.
Other methods: Other methods like using peat moss or adding natural supplements like Seachem Flourish Excel can also be effective fertilization techniques. Peat moss can help to lower the pH of the aquarium water and provide essential nutrients to the plants, while natural supplements can provide essential nutrients like iron and carbon.
The Role Of CO2 Injection In Planted Aquariums
Carbon dioxide (CO2) is a crucial element for plant growth, and it plays a vital role in maintaining a healthy planted aquarium.
In a planted aquarium, CO2 is naturally present in the water, but often at low concentrations that are not sufficient for the plants’ needs. By injecting additional CO2 into the aquarium, hobbyists can increase the concentration of CO2 in the water, providing the plants with the necessary carbon for photosynthesis.
CO2 injection can be achieved through a variety of methods, including CO2 injection systems, DIY yeast-based systems, and liquid CO2 supplements. CO2 injection systems are the most effective and precise method of adding CO2 to an aquarium, as they allow for precise control of CO2 levels. They typically consist of a CO2 tank, regulator, and diffuser, which work together to inject CO2 into the water.
The benefits of CO2 injection in planted aquariums are numerous. Increased CO2 levels can lead to faster and more robust plant growth, improved plant health, and more vibrant colors in the plants. CO2 injection can also help to prevent algae growth by encouraging plant growth, which can outcompete algae for nutrients in the water.
However, adding too much CO2 can be harmful to fish and other aquatic animals in the aquarium. Many non-demanding plants do just fine without CO2.
If you choose not to inject CO2 into your planted aquarium, there are still steps you can take to support healthy plant growth. These include providing adequate lighting, choosing plant species that are well-suited to your aquarium’s conditions, and providing regular fertilization with a balanced liquid fertilizer or root tabs.
Maintaining Water Quality In A Planted Aquarium
Maintaining water quality is essential for the health and well-being of both fish and live aquatic plants in a planted aquarium. Here are some key tips for maintaining water quality in your planted aquarium:
- Monitor water parameters: Regularly test the water for pH, ammonia, nitrite, and nitrate levels using a quality test kit. Aim to keep pH levels between 6.5 and 7.5, ammonia and nitrite levels at 0 ppm, and nitrate levels below 20 ppm.
- Conduct regular water changes: Regular water changes are necessary to remove excess nutrients, organic waste, and toxins from the aquarium. A good rule of thumb is to change 10-20% of the water every 10 days.
- Use a high-quality filtration system: A quality filtration system is crucial for maintaining water quality in a planted aquarium. Choose a filter that is appropriately sized for your aquarium and consider adding additional filtration media, such as activated carbon, to remove impurities and improve water clarity.
- Avoid overfeeding: Overfeeding is a common cause of poor water quality in aquariums. Feed your fish only what they can consume in a minute and remove any uneaten food from the aquarium.
- Regularly prune and remove dead plant matter: Regular pruning and removing of dead plant matter can help prevent decay and maintain water quality in your aquarium.
By following these tips and regularly monitoring your aquarium’s water parameters, you can help maintain high water quality and support healthy growth for both your live aquatic plants and fish.
Creating A Natural-Looking Aquascape With Live Aquarium Plants
Here are some key tips for achieving a beautiful and natural-looking planted aquarium:
- Choose natural-looking hardscape materials: Hardscape materials such as rocks, driftwood, and natural stones can help create a natural-looking environment in your aquarium. Avoid using plastic or brightly coloured decorations that may detract from the natural aesthetic.
- Use different plant species that complement each other: Using a variety of plant species can help create a diverse and natural-looking environment in your aquarium. Consider choosing plants with different colors, textures, and sizes to create a visually appealing and realistic aquascape.
- Pay attention to plant placement: Arrange the plants in a way that mimics their natural growth patterns. This can help create a more organic look.
- Incorporate driftwood and rocks: Adding driftwood and rocks can help create a natural-looking environment in your aquarium. Arrange them in a way that mimics natural formations, such as riverbanks or rocky outcrops.
- Use a natural-looking substrate: Using a natural-looking substrate, such as sand or gravel, can help create a natural look in your aquarium. Avoid using brightly coloured or artificial substrates that may detract from the natural aesthetic.
- Pay attention to lighting: Ensure that your plants are receiving the appropriate amount and intensity of light. Consider using a timer to simulate natural lighting cycles.
- Add appropriate fish and invertebrates: Adding fish and invertebrates that are either native to the aquatic environment you are trying to recreate or ones that complement the plants will create a cohesive and harmonious aquascape.
Tips For Trimming And Pruning Aquatic Plants In A Planted Aquarium
Trimming and pruning aquatic plants is an essential part of maintaining a healthy and thriving planted aquarium. Here are some techniques for trimming and pruning aquatic plants in a planted aquarium:
- Use sharp scissors or pruning shears: Use sharp scissors or pruning shears to trim your aquatic plants. Dull tools can damage the plants and make them more susceptible to disease.
- Remove dead or damaged leaves: Dead or damaged leaves can leach nutrients into the water and create a breeding ground for harmful bacteria. Remove these leaves as soon as you notice them to prevent further decay.
- Trim overgrown stems: Overgrown stems can block light and nutrients from reaching the lower leaves of the plant. Trim these stems to encourage new growth and promote healthy plant growth.
- Prune roots and runners: Roots and runners that grow too long can become unsightly and take up valuable space in your aquarium. Trim these roots and runners as needed to maintain a clean and healthy aquarium.
- Be gentle: When trimming and pruning your plants, be gentle to avoid damaging the plant or its root system. Make clean cuts and avoid tearing or pulling on the plant.
The Benefits Of Live Aquarium Plants For Fish Health And Wellbeing
Live aquarium plants offer a wide range of benefits for fish health and wellbeing. Here are some of the key benefits of live aquarium plants for fish:
- Oxygenation: Live aquarium plants play a critical role in oxygenating the water in your aquarium. Through photosynthesis, plants release oxygen into the water, providing a vital source of oxygen for your fish.
- Water filtration: Live aquarium plants can also help filter and purify the water in your aquarium. Plants absorb harmful substances such as nitrates, nitrites, and ammonia, which can reduce the risk of water pollution and improve the overall health of your fish.
- Natural environment: Live aquarium plants can help create a natural environment that mimics the fish’s natural habitat, reducing stress and promoting overall wellbeing.
- Hiding places: Live aquarium plants provide hiding places for fish, which can help reduce stress and aggression in your fish community.
- Algae control: Live aquarium plants can help control the growth of algae in your aquarium. They can compete with algae for nutrients.
- Aesthetic appeal: Live aquarium plants can add color, texture, and beauty to your aquarium, creating a visually appealing environment for both your fish and you.
